Subject: Re: [PATCH] topology: make for_each_node_with_cpus() O(N)

Hi Yury,

On Fri, May 09, 2025 at 12:20:08PM -0400, Yury Norov wrote:
> From: Yury Norov [NVIDIA] <yury.norov@...il.com>
> 
> for_each_node_with_cpus() calls nr_cpus_node() at every iteration, which
> makes it O(N^2). Kernel tracks such nodes with N_CPU record in node_states
> array. Switching to it makes for_each_node_with_cpus() O(N).

Makes sense to me.

Maybe we should mention that previously we were only considering online
nodes with CPUs assigned. Now, we can include also offline nodes with CPUs
assigned (assuming it's possible)?

Semantically speaking, since the name doesn't include "online", it seems
more logical to ignore the state of the node. And if checking the online
state is required, the user can just use node_online() within the loop.
